Nestled in the heart of Mauritius, the Black River Gorge is a breathtaking natural wonder that captivates visitors with its dramatic landscapes, lush forests, and diverse wildlife. This stunning ravine is a paradise for nature lovers and adventurers alike, offering countless opportunities for hiking, birdwatching, and exploring the rich flora and fauna of the region.

Local tips
- Wear comfortable hiking shoes, as some trails can be steep and rugged.
- Bring plenty of water and snacks to keep your energy up during your hikes.
- Consider hiring a local guide to enhance your experience and learn more about the area's ecology.
- Visit early in the morning to enjoy cooler temperatures and fewer crowds.
- Don't forget your camera for capturing the stunning views and unique wildlife.

Getting There
-
Walking
From the center of Black River, start at the main bus stop located on the main road. Head south on the main road (Royal Road) towards the coast. Continue walking until you reach the intersection with Route No. 10. Turn left onto Route No. 10. Keep walking for about 1.5 km until you reach the entrance to Black River Gorges National Park. Follow the signs to the visitor center, which is located approximately 500 meters into the park.
-
Public Transport (Bus)
From the main bus stop in Black River, take the bus heading towards Chamarel or the Black River Gorges area. Make sure to ask the driver to drop you off at the closest stop to Black River Gorges National Park. Once you disembark, follow the signs to the park entrance, which is about a 10-minute walk from the bus stop.
-
Bicycle
If you have access to a bicycle, start from the center of Black River and ride south along Royal Road. After approximately 2 km, turn left onto Route No. 10. Continue to cycle for another 1.5 km until you see the entrance to Black River Gorges National Park. You can park your bicycle at the visitor center before exploring the gorge.
